The project for a pageant of London, of which so much was heard a year or two ago came to nothing, but the Crysta' Palace is to bo the theatre next summer of hat promises to be one of the most remarkable of the series of spectacles which bare been witnessed up and down the country since the interesting revival began It is to be hold in connection with the Festival of Empire," and will be on grand scale, no less than 15,000 performers taking part in it. The Crystal Palace, with its fins terraces and widespreading grounds, is an ideal place for a splendid pageant.
